Sometimes, historical figures seem so serious that we don’t think of them having friends, like any of us do. This unique set offers a fresh take on traditional biographies. It spotlights important friendships between American icons, such as Founding Fathers George Washington and Alexander Hamilton and women’s rights trailblazers Susan B. Anthony and Elizabeth Cady Stanton. Readers will learn how these dynamic duos met, the events they experienced together, and how their relationship affected their lives and future generations. Features include: Specially chosen photographs and images highlight the eras. Fact boxes provide further historical background. Uses a high-interest lens through which to educate readers about important figures and events in U.S. history. Quotations from primary sources enhance readers’ understanding of people and events.
